Early Life And Career Breakthrough
Roots In Trenchtown
Born in Trenchtown, Jamaica, Bob Marley experienced poverty and political tension early on. These conditions shaped his empathy and later became themes in his songs. His raw talent emerged through local performances, catching the attention of established producers.
Formation Of The Wailers
Marley formed The Wailers with Peter Tosh and Bunny Wailer, blending ska, rocksteady, and emerging reggae influences. Their breakthrough came with tracks like "Simmer Down," resonating with listeners across Jamaica and soon beyond. The group signed international deals that set the stage for global recognition.
Peak Fame And Albums Revenue
Album Sales Impact
Albums such as "Natty Dread," "Rastaman Vibration," and "Exodus" expanded his audience worldwide. Strong sales, coupled with touring, generated significant cash flow. These recordings remain best-sellers in catalog music markets.
Global Tours And Ticket Revenue
World tours attracted massive crowds, spreading reggae to new continents. Live performances created major revenue streams and cemented his status as a cultural force. Stage energy and consistent setlists kept fans returning and spending.
Posthumous Earnings And Legacy Business
Catalog And Rights Management
Controlled by Tuff Gong and licensing partners, his catalog earns substantial royalties. Streaming platforms contribute recurring income, while film and advertising placements add lump sums. Rights management ensures continued value from original recordings.
Merchandising And Brand Deals
Licensed apparel, accessories, and collectibles generate steady revenue. Brands align with Marley’s image to tap into his global appeal. Ethical partnerships often highlight social causes he supported, reinforcing positive associations.
